Police say a Tulsa teen shot and killed his stepfather Thursday evening.  

It happened just before 9 p.m in the 1200 block of South Winston.

Officers say the 17-year-old called police, telling them he had just shot his 40-year-old stepfather. Sgt. Dave Walker says the teen and his 48-year-old mother told police the stepfather was intoxicated and making threats to his wife.  

Officers say the teen told police he picked up a shotgun and was sitting in the den of the home with his mother. 

When the stepfather approached the stepson and grabbed the teen's arm, the stepson fired the gun once, hitting the stepfather in the chest, according to police.

Sgt. Walker says the stepson was not arrested, but the investigation continues.

This is Tulsa's 72nd homicide of the year.
